diff options
author | Reinier Zwitserloot <reinier@zwitserloot.com> | 2014-10-29 20:36:27 +0100 |
---|---|---|
committer | Reinier Zwitserloot <reinier@zwitserloot.com> | 2014-10-29 20:36:27 +0100 |
commit | f5819f11f4f924adaf012ac927c798191e112848 (patch) | |
tree | 71e17ab1e5b94223c57668f02c143ebb3235e1cb /src/eclipseAgent/lombok/eclipse/agent | |
parent | 980c913fbca3a32542b5e3434a13bf176ca697f2 (diff) | |
download | lombok-f5819f11f4f924adaf012ac927c798191e112848.tar.gz lombok-f5819f11f4f924adaf012ac927c798191e112848.tar.bz2 lombok-f5819f11f4f924adaf012ac927c798191e112848.zip |
[shadowloader] simple bugfix; shadowloader wasn’t working in luna.
Diffstat (limited to 'src/eclipseAgent/lombok/eclipse/agent')
-rw-r--r-- | src/eclipseAgent/lombok/eclipse/agent/EclipseLoaderPatcher.java |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/eclipseAgent/lombok/eclipse/agent/EclipseLoaderPatcher.java b/src/eclipseAgent/lombok/eclipse/agent/EclipseLoaderPatcher.java index c9b8ca85..0d21c212 100644 --- a/src/eclipseAgent/lombok/eclipse/agent/EclipseLoaderPatcher.java +++ b/src/eclipseAgent/lombok/eclipse/agent/EclipseLoaderPatcher.java @@ -22,10 +22,10 @@ public class EclipseLoaderPatcher { public static Class<?> overrideLoadResult(ClassLoader original, String name, boolean resolve) throws ClassNotFoundException { try { - Field shadowLoaderField = original.getClass().getDeclaredField("lombok$shadowLoader"); + Field shadowLoaderField = original.getClass().getField("lombok$shadowLoader"); ClassLoader shadowLoader = (ClassLoader) shadowLoaderField.get(original); if (shadowLoader == null) { - String jarLoc = (String) original.getClass().getDeclaredField("lombok$location").get(null); + String jarLoc = (String) original.getClass().getField("lombok$location").get(null); JarFile jf = new JarFile(jarLoc); InputStream in = null; try { |